I am the president of our association with approx 200 members. I know of three who are diabetics. In all cases, they monitor their levels before the game, hydrate well during the game, and monitor again after the game. We had one who experienced some problems on a hot and humid July 4th during his third game of the day. He now limits himself to stay within his physical constraints.

As was said in the above post; they enjoy this enough to have learned how to work around it. I applaud them!
